An MBA degree equips you with advanced business knowledge and leadership skills. This is a two-year postgraduate course in management. You will learn about areas like finance, marketing, human resources, and strategy, preparing you for managerial roles across various industries. You can pursue it in different modes, including online MBA, distance MBA, and traditional MBA. It offers specialisations in different domains such as:
| PG Course Name | Master of Business Administration (MBA) |
|---|---|
| Duration | 2 Years |
| Eligibility Criteria | Must have completed a bachelor’s degree in any stream with a minimum of 40%-50% (the minimum marks requirement may vary in different universities) |
| Study Stream | Management |
| Admission Criteria | CAT/MAT/XAT/GMAT/NMAT |
| Career Opportunities | Management Consulting Financial Analyst HR Manager Business Analytics Marketing Manager Operations Management |

MSc courses focus on a specific field of study within the science subjects. An M.Sc. degree deepens your knowledge in a particular scientific field, such as biology, chemistry, or physics. You’ll conduct research, analyse data, and develop expertise in your chosen scientific discipline. Typically, an MSc course in India lasts two years. This is one of the most popular PG courses in India. It provides specialisations in the following domains:
| PG Course Name | Master of Science (M.Sc.) |
|---|---|
| Duration | 2 Years |
| Eligibility Criteria | Bachelor’s degree in science from a recognised college/university. |
| Study Stream | Science |
| Admission Criteria | CUET PG / GATE / IIT JAM / or merit-based |
| Career Opportunities | Scientist Data Analyst Research Assistant Data Scientist Statistician |

Expand your engineering expertise through an M.Tech, a 2-year duration programme. If you have an engineering background and have completed a B.Tech, then you can pursue an M.Tech. It will help you secure technology-related job opportunities. M.Tech is one of the highly in-demand PG courses in India for engineering. Some of the M.Tech specialisations are listed below:
| PG Course Name | Master of Technology (M.Tech) |
|---|---|
| Duration | 2 Years |
| Eligibility Criteria | Must have passed B.Tech from a recognised college/university. |
| Study Stream | Engineering |
| Admission Criteria | GATE or online application |
| Career Opportunities | Software Engineer Software Developer Research Analyst Web Designing IT and Software Firms |

A Master of Arts (M.A.) involves advanced study in humanities and social sciences subjects like history, literature, psychology, or sociology. You’ll develop critical thinking, research, and communication skills in your chosen field. It is a 2-year duration programme, generally pursued after a Bachelor of Arts (B.A.). If you are looking for PG courses after BCom, an MA in a related stream is a good option. Some of the popular MA specialisations are listed below.
| PG Course Name | Master of Arts (M.A.) |
|---|---|
| Duration | 2 Years |
| Eligibility Criteria | Candidates with a bachelor’s degree (preferably arts (B.A.)) or its equivalent (10+2+3) |
| Study Stream | Arts & Humanities |
| Admission Criteria | JUNEE / CUET PG / Online Application / Merit-based |
| Career Opportunities | Graphic Designer Art Teacher Teacher Journalist Artist Writer |

Another option in the in-demand PG courses list is MCA. The Master of Computer Applications (MCA) degree course builds upon your computer science background. You will gain advanced programming skills, software development expertise, and knowledge of various computer applications, preparing you for IT careers. MCA is usually pursued by BCA aspirants. However, you could pursue an MCA after graduation in any discipline with mathematics, having studied at the 10+2 or graduation level. Some of the top MCA specialisations are listed below.
| PG Course Name | Master of Computer Applications (MCA) |
|---|---|
| Duration | 2 Years |
| Eligibility Criteria | Candidates with BCA / B.Sc. / BIT / B.E. / B.Tech, with Mathematics or Statistics as one of the subjects from a recognised institution with a course duration of a minimum of 3 years. |
| Study Stream | Computer Science/Applications |
| Admission Criteria | NIMCET/MAH CET/CET/Merit-based |
| Career Opportunities | Software Developer Hardware Engineer Business Analyst Database Engineer Technical Writer |

The Master of Laws, also called LLM, is a specialised degree for law graduates seeking expertise in a particular legal area, like tax law, international law, or intellectual property law. An LLM allows you to specialise and advance your legal career. It is one of the best PG courses in the law discipline. You can pursue this PG course after completing an LLB degree. Some colleges also offer LLB-LLM integrated courses.
| PG Course Name | Master of Laws (LLM) |
|---|---|
| Duration | 1-2 Years |
| Eligibility Criteria | Candidates must have completed an LLB or a five-year integrated LLB from a recognised university. |
| Study Stream | Law |
| Admission Criteria | CUET LLM / CLAT PG |
| Career Opportunities | Corporate Lawyer Legal Advisor Advocate Civil Advocate Judge |

Popularly known as MPharm, Master of Pharmacy is a two-year post-graduate (PG) programme. The study of pharmaceuticals and medications is the focus of pharmaceutical sciences, which form the basis of this course. It improves students’ theoretical, technical, and practical understanding of pharmacy while encouraging them to conduct additional pharmaceutical research.
| PG Course Name | Master of Pharmacy (MPharm) |
|---|---|
| Duration | 2 Years |
| Eligibility Criteria | Candidates must hold a bachelor’s degree in pharmacy (BPharm) with a minimum percentage of marks ranging from 45% to 60%, depending on the college. |
| Study Stream | Medicine |
| Admission Criteria | CUET PG / GPAT |
| Career Opportunities | Medical Transcriptionist Health Care Unit Manager Lab Technician Drug Inspector Research Associate |

Master of Education is a 2-year postgraduate programme. The purpose of an M.Ed. is to assist instructors in improving their teaching skills, pedagogy, and subject matter expertise. In addition, it can put educators in a position to advance into leadership positions, such as those of higher education administrators, legislators, or school principals.
| PG Course Name | Master of Education (MEd) |
|---|---|
| Duration | 2 Years |
| Eligibility Criteria | Candidates who have obtained a B.Ed. degree are eligible for admission. |
| Study Stream | Education |
| Admission Criteria | Merit-Based / CUET PG / IPU CET |
| Career Opportunities | Education Consultant Instructional Coordinator School Counselor Policy Analyst Tutor Educational Researcher |

A post-graduate diploma in management is a popular PG course. It is available in one/two years of duration, depending on the colleges. A PGDM is generally considered equivalent to an MBA degree as it emphasises similar areas of management. The two-year postgraduate Diploma in Management (PGDM) programme allows management aspirants to acquire hard and soft skills to become market-ready management professionals. It is designed to meet industry needs.
| PG Course Name | Post Graduate Diploma in Management (PGDM) |
|---|---|
| Duration | 1 – 2 Years (course & college dependent) |
| Eligibility Criteria | Candidates with graduation from a UGC-recognised university |
| Study Stream | Certification/Management |
| Admission Criteria | CAT / XAT / MAT / Online Application (Merit) |
| Career Opportunities | Human Resource Manager Digital Marketing Manager International Business Consultant Market Research Analyst |

An MD is a postgraduate degree in medicine, which stands for Doctor of Medicine. It is a 2-year specialised degree in medicine. Doctors with MDs are allopathic doctors. This means that they use standard medical instruments, such as X-rays, prescription medications, and surgery, to treat and diagnose ailments. Conventional or mainstream medicine is another term for allopathic medicine. Physicians with a general practice background can choose to practice family medicine or primary care. This is among the in-demand PG courses in the medical field.
| PG Course Name | Doctor of Medicine (MD) |
|---|---|
| Duration | 2 Years |
| Eligibility Criteria | Candidates must have received their MBBS from an accredited university with ICMR approval. Additionally, candidates must have finished the required one-year internship. MD admissions depend on the results of entrance examinations. |
| Study Stream | Medicine |
| Admission Criteria | NEET PG, INICET |
| Career Opportunities | Doctor Surgeon Dentist Pharmacist |
